Laminin alpha 1 Rabbit Polyclonal Antibody (Biotin)

Laminin alpha 1 Rabbit Polyclonal Antibody (Biotin) is a Biotin conjugated antibody targeting LAMA1. This antibody is suitable for WB. It exhibits reactivity with Human samples.
